I was really looking forward to brunch in Balthazar after reading all the hype associated with this restaurant.
We ordered a pastry basket which was a total waste of $16. It essentially was full of bread and only one sticky bun and something resembling a donut. There were no croissants or anything exciting there. I am a huge fan of wild mushrooms, so I ordered mushroom eggs in puff pastry. Eggs were average, but the puff pastry was dry and tasteless. My husband ordered poached egg with polenta, which was very average as well. I was really surprised, as we have eaten at Pastis, owned by same people, and loved it. I was expecting Balthazar to be better the Pastis, which it clearly wasn't. Bottom line, skip it!

This is one of my favorite places to eat in the whole city. The bread is something i dream about its so good, and having lived in France for a while i can tell you that everything at Balthazars lives up to its sophisticated French menu. Must haves are the croissants (perfectly lamented with beautiful honeycomb texture inside), the french onion soup, with its caramelized onions and cheese, and (when its on the menu) the pumpkin ravioli are too die for, oh and the french fries: pure bliss
and i always finish my meals there off with a fabulous authentic french cappucino
